what is the answer for y=2x-5 and 4x-y=7

Substitute the first equation into the second equation. You will get:

4x - (2x - 5) = 7

Distribute the negative sign into the parenthesis:

4x - 2x + 5 = 7

Simplify

2x + 5 = 7

Subtract 5 on both sides

2x = 2

x = 1

Now, substitute x = 1 into the first equation:

y = 2(1) - 5

y = 2 - 5

y = -3


The solution to the system of equations is (1, -3).
